Recombinant Expression and Immobilization of Pantoea dispersa DJL-B Alcohol Dehydrogenase
To enhance the expression level of recombinant alcohol dehydrogenase in E. coli BL21 (DE3), this study investigated the effects of induction temperature, induction time, and IPTG concentration on enzyme expression through one-way experiments.
